{"h1": "Radiology Technologist Job Description", "p": "At TMS Services, we are seeking a highly skilled Radiology Technologist to contribute to our team. As a Radiology Technologist, you will play a critical role in ensuring the highest quality imaging services for our patients. Your expertise will be essential in preparing patients for scans, positioning them correctly, and operating imaging equipment to produce high-quality images.

Responsibilities:

* Follow instructions from physicians regarding imaging procedures
* Position patients correctly and adjust imaging equipment to specified positions
* Prevent unnecessary radiation exposure by using protective gear
* Maintain accurate patient records
* Ensure a safe and clean working environment

Requirements:

* Excellent communication skills to explain procedures to patients and communicate test results to doctors and staff
* Ability to calibrate and maintain radiology equipment
